本文主要介绍了如何运用ZBlogPHP设置伪静态规则来提升网站吸引力,伪静态规则能够将动态网址转化为简洁易记的静态网址,从而提高用户体验与搜索引擎友好度,我们首先解析了ZBlogPHP中伪静态规则的实现原理,接着详细阐述了配置步骤,并通过实例演示了具体的应用,文章强调了合理运用伪静态规则对网站发展的重要性。
随着互联网技术的飞速发展,传统的动态网页已不能满足日益增长的用户需求,静态网页以其易于更新、成本低廉等优势逐渐成为主流,传统的PHP网站需要借助数据库和服务器端脚本语言来实现动态内容展示,这无疑增加了维护的难度与成本,为此,ZBlogPHP应运而生,为我们带来了更为简洁高效的解决方案。
我们将重点探讨ZBlogPHP如何巧妙地运用伪静态规则,优化网站的访问速度和用户体验。
伪静态规则概述
伪静态规则是一种通过URL重写技术将动态URL转换为看起来像静态URL的机制,这种规则不仅提高了网站性能,还使得URL更加友好和易于记忆。
ZBlogPHP伪静态规则详解
ZBlogPHP作为国内优秀的博客程序,其对伪静态规则的实现尤为出色,以下是几种常见的伪静态规则设置方式:
-
单页面应用(SPA)模式:
对于注重用户体验的博客,可以采用SPA模式,即将所有数据通过Ajax请求获取并动态渲染到页面上,在ZBlogPHP中,可以通过配置
.htaccess文件或Nginx配置来实现路由的重写,将动态参数转换为静态URL。 -
自定义别名:
用户可以为博客文章自定义不同的别名,以便更简洁地表达URL主题或关键词,ZBlogPHP支持通过正则表达式和函数对动态URL进行解析和重写,将自定义别名映射到实际的动态文件路径上。
-
分类目录型网站:
对于拥有大量分类的主题博客,可以借助伪静态规则构建清晰的目录结构,将每篇文章的ID或标题作为目录项,并使用斜杠或反斜杠等符号将分类和文章名称串联起来,形成易于理解和浏览的URL路径。
-
友好的标签链接:
ZBlogPHP还支持将文章标签作为链接的重要组成部分,通过对动态URL进行精心的设计和解析,可以将特定的标签组合转化为简洁明了且具有描述性的静态链接。
伪静态规则的配置方法
不同的Web服务器配置方法会有所不同,以下是一些通用的配置步骤:
-
Apache服务器:
打开Apache配置文件
.htaccess,添加相关规则,并重启Apache服务使更改生效。 -
Nginx服务器:
在Nginx配置文件中找到相应的location或server块,添加重写规则并重启Nginx服务使更改生效。
伪静态规则的优化与维护
合理地运用伪静态规则可以显著提升网站的性能与用户体验,但在实际应用中仍需注意以下几点:保持规则简洁清晰,避免过于复杂的逻辑影响服务器性能;定期检查规则有效性并及时调整;充分考虑搜索引擎优化(SEO)需求等。
通过深入理解和掌握ZBlogPHP的伪静态规则,您可以更加自如地打造高性能、易维护的博客平台,从而吸引更多的读者关注和分享您的作品。


还没有评论,来说两句吧...